南海ODP184航次1148站位渐新世沟鞭藻生物地层

摘    要:大洋钻探184航次1148站位从南海当前的深海陆坡区取得了距今32.8Ma以来的沉积纪录,其中渐新世(32.8—23.8Ma)沉积包含了丰富的沟鞭藻化石,通过定量和定性结合的分析方法对沟鞭藻进行了研究。依据可指示地层时代关键种的最高产出层位和沟鞭藻组合特征,建立了1个组合带和2个亚带:Cleistosphaeridium diver-sispinosum组合带(A带)、Enneadocysta pectiniformis亚带(A-1亚带)和Cordosphaeridium gracile亚带(A-2亚带)。由Cl.diversispinosum、Co.gracile、Hystrichokolpoma pusillum和Homotryblium vallum的最高产出层位标定A带顶界,时代为渐新世;据Enneadocysta partridgei和E.pectiniformis最高产出层位划分出A-1亚带和A-2亚带;由E.partridgei,E.pectiniformis和Phthanoperidinium amoenum的生存时限可确定A-1亚带为早渐新世鲁培尔期(Rupelian);由Co.gracile,Distatodinium ellipticum,Wetzeliella articulata,W.gochtii和W.symmetrica等种的最高产出层位和分布时限可确定A-2亚带为晚渐新世夏特期(Chattian)。根据共存的沟鞭藻属种特征,新建立的化石带在不同程度上可与世界其他地区的同期沟鞭藻化石带或组合带进行对比,某些关键沟鞭藻种共存有助于确定化石带的年龄。
